Kane and Abel Series

The Kane and Abel trilogy follows two men born on the same day in 1906 into radically different worlds. William Lowell Kane inherits the expectations of a Boston banking dynasty, while the Polish child Władek Koskiewicz survives war, revolution and migration before rebuilding himself in the United States as hotelier Abel Rosnovski. Their parallel rise through finance, property and social ambition turns into a feud that reaches across the First World War, the Great Depression and the Second World War.

The Prodigal Daughter transfers the centre of the story to Abel’s daughter Florentyna and William’s son Richard, whose marriage joins families their fathers tried to keep apart. Florentyna’s career carries the saga into Congress, the Senate and the struggle for the American presidency. Shall We Tell the President? then changes register from family chronicle to political thriller, placing President Florentyna Kane at the centre of a six-day FBI investigation into an assassination conspiracy.
